Global Payments Inc. (GPN) has released its first quarter 2026 financial results, demonstrating continued resilience in the payments sector amid evolving market conditions. The company reported earnings per share of $2.96 on revenue of $7.71 billion, reflecting the underlying strength of its merchant processing and financial technology solutions portfolios.
